Pros & Cons
👍 Pros
- Offers 146GB of storage capacity, suitable for boot drives or specific high-performance applications.
- Features a high spindle speed of 10,000 RPM, delivering faster data access and improved performance for critical workloads.
- Utilizes a SAS interface, known for its robustness, reliability, and advanced features in enterprise environments.
- Its 2.5-inch form factor makes it ideal for compact server chassis and high-density storage solutions.
- Branded by Dell, indicating potential compatibility and optimization for Dell server systems.
👎 Cons
- The 146GB capacity is quite limited for general storage needs in modern server or enterprise applications.
- A 10,000 RPM SAS drive typically consumes more power and generates more heat compared to slower SATA drives or SSDs.
- The SAS interface is designed for enterprise systems, meaning it is not compatible with standard desktop computer SATA ports.
